快速傅里叶变换(FFT)与离散傅里叶变换(DFT)深入讲解PPT
版权申诉
148 浏览量
更新于2024-10-26
收藏 381KB RAR 举报
资源摘要信息: "数字信号处理中非常重要的一环是傅里叶变换的应用,具体到快速傅里叶变换(FFT),离散傅里叶变换(DFT)以及Chirp-Z变换(CZT)。这些变换是现代信号处理、图像处理、语音识别等领域不可或缺的工具。本PPT将全面深入地讲解这些变换的原理、实现方法及应用场景,帮助学习者建立扎实的理论基础,提升实际应用能力。
FFT(快速傅里叶变换)是DFT(离散傅里叶变换)的一种快速算法。由于直接计算DFT的时间复杂度为O(N^2),而FFT可以将这个过程的时间复杂度降低到O(NlogN),因此在实际应用中,FFT算法大大提高了处理效率。FFT在频域分析、数字信号处理、图像处理等领域被广泛应用。
CZT(Chirp-Z变换)是一种比FFT更通用的算法,它可以看作是DFT的扩展。在某些特定的应用场景下,比如窄带信号分析、频谱分析等,CZT表现出比FFT更高效的性能。CZT允许用户自定义变换的起始点、终止点和采样点数,因此能够更灵活地处理信号。
这个PPT材料将为学习者提供一系列关于FFT和CZT的理论知识,包括算法原理、数学推导和实现步骤。除此之外,还会有大量的实例分析,通过具体的案例来展示如何在实际工程中应用这些算法来解决复杂问题。通过这些内容的学习,观众将能够更加深入地理解信号频域分析和处理的技巧,以及如何利用现代信号处理工具来提高工作的效率和准确性。
在内容安排上,PPT将覆盖以下几个重要方面:
1. 傅里叶变换的数学基础和物理意义,包括连续傅里叶变换(Continuous Fourier Transform)和离散傅里叶变换(Discrete Fourier Transform)。
2. 快速傅里叶变换(Fast Fourier Transform)的快速算法原理,如何将DFT的时间复杂度降低到对数级别。
3. Chirp-Z变换(Chirp-Z Transform)的介绍和优势,相比FFT的适用场景和性能比较。
4. FFT和CZT在数字信号处理中的应用,例如在语音分析、图像处理、雷达信号处理等领域的案例分析。
5. 如何使用编程语言(如MATLAB、Python等)实现FFT和CZT算法,以及如何在实际项目中进行优化。
6. 现代数字信号处理的其他高级话题,例如窗函数、谱分析、信号重构等。
通过这个PPT的学习,观众将能够掌握数字信号处理的核心技术,为从事通信、电子、声学、遥感等领域的研究工作打下坚实的基础。"
资源摘要信息:"在数字信号处理(DSP)中,掌握快速傅里叶变换(FFT)及其相关算法对于理解和应用是非常关键的。本PPT内容深入,全面地讲解了FFT和离散傅里叶变换(DFT)之间的关系、原理以及CZT(Chirp-Z变换)的应用。通过本材料的学习,将帮助学习者深刻理解这些变换的概念和计算方法,并能够在实际中应用这些技术,从而有效提高数字信号处理的效率和质量。PPT的名称表明了其内容专注于第四章的快速傅里叶变换FFT,这暗示着课程内容的深入性和专业性,面向的是有一定DSP背景知识的专业人士或学生。"
2022-07-14 上传
2022-07-15 上传
2022-07-14 上传
2024-09-11 上传
2023-06-25 上传
2024-09-11 上传
2024-09-11 上传
2024-09-11 上传
2024-10-12 上传
周楷雯
- 粉丝: 93
- 资源: 1万+
最新资源
- MATLAB实现小波阈值去噪:Visushrink硬软算法对比
- 易语言实现画板图像缩放功能教程
- 大模型推荐系统: 优化算法与模型压缩技术
- Stancy: 静态文件驱动的简单RESTful API与前端框架集成
- 掌握Java全文搜索:深入Apache Lucene开源系统
- 19计应19田超的Python7-1试题整理
- 易语言实现多线程网络时间同步源码解析
- 人工智能大模型学习与实践指南
- 掌握Markdown:从基础到高级技巧解析
- JS-PizzaStore: JS应用程序模拟披萨递送服务
- CAMV开源XML编辑器:编辑、验证、设计及架构工具集
- 医学免疫学情景化自动生成考题系统
- 易语言实现多语言界面编程教程
- MATLAB实现16种回归算法在数据挖掘中的应用
- ***内容构建指南:深入HTML与LaTeX
- Python实现维基百科“历史上的今天”数据抓取教程